Atoms Crowd  4.1.0
Atoms::DrawContext Member List

This is the complete list of members for Atoms::DrawContext, including all inherited members.

disable(unsigned int mode)=0 (defined in Atoms::DrawContext)Atoms::DrawContextpure virtual
enable(unsigned int mode)=0 (defined in Atoms::DrawContext)Atoms::DrawContextpure virtual
isEnabled(unsigned int mode)=0 (defined in Atoms::DrawContext)Atoms::DrawContextpure virtual
lineLoop(const std::vector< AtomsCore::Vector3 > &points)=0 (defined in Atoms::DrawContext)Atoms::DrawContextpure virtual
lineLoop2d(const std::vector< AtomsCore::Vector2 > &points)=0 (defined in Atoms::DrawContext)Atoms::DrawContextpure virtual
lines(const std::vector< AtomsCore::Vector3 > &points)=0 (defined in Atoms::DrawContext)Atoms::DrawContextpure virtual
lines2d(const std::vector< AtomsCore::Vector2 > &points)=0 (defined in Atoms::DrawContext)Atoms::DrawContextpure virtual
lineStrip(const std::vector< AtomsCore::Vector3 > &points)=0 (defined in Atoms::DrawContext)Atoms::DrawContextpure virtual
lineStrip(const std::vector< AtomsCore::Vector3f > &points)=0 (defined in Atoms::DrawContext)Atoms::DrawContextpure virtual
lineStrip2d(const std::vector< AtomsCore::Vector2 > &points)=0 (defined in Atoms::DrawContext)Atoms::DrawContextpure virtual
loadIdentity()=0 (defined in Atoms::DrawContext)Atoms::DrawContextpure virtual
loadMatrix(const AtomsCore::Matrix &mtx)=0 (defined in Atoms::DrawContext)Atoms::DrawContextpure virtual
matrixMode(unsigned int mode)=0 (defined in Atoms::DrawContext)Atoms::DrawContextpure virtual
mesh(const std::vector< AtomsCore::Vector3f > &points, const std::vector< AtomsCore::Vector3f > &normals, const std::vector< unsigned int > &indices)=0 (defined in Atoms::DrawContext)Atoms::DrawContextpure virtual
multMatrix(const AtomsCore::Matrix &mtx)=0 (defined in Atoms::DrawContext)Atoms::DrawContextpure virtual
ortho2D(double l, double r, double b, double t)=0 (defined in Atoms::DrawContext)Atoms::DrawContextpure virtual
points(const std::vector< AtomsCore::Vector3 > &points)=0 (defined in Atoms::DrawContext)Atoms::DrawContextpure virtual
points2d(const std::vector< AtomsCore::Vector2 > &points)=0 (defined in Atoms::DrawContext)Atoms::DrawContextpure virtual
popAttrib()=0 (defined in Atoms::DrawContext)Atoms::DrawContextpure virtual
popClientAttrib()=0 (defined in Atoms::DrawContext)Atoms::DrawContextpure virtual
popMatrix()=0 (defined in Atoms::DrawContext)Atoms::DrawContextpure virtual
pushAttrib(unsigned int value)=0 (defined in Atoms::DrawContext)Atoms::DrawContextpure virtual
pushClientAttrib(unsigned int value)=0 (defined in Atoms::DrawContext)Atoms::DrawContextpure virtual
pushMatrix()=0 (defined in Atoms::DrawContext)Atoms::DrawContextpure virtual
rotate(double angle, const AtomsCore::Vector3 &value)=0 (defined in Atoms::DrawContext)Atoms::DrawContextpure virtual
scale(const AtomsCore::Vector3 &value)=0 (defined in Atoms::DrawContext)Atoms::DrawContextpure virtual
setColor(const AtomsCore::Vector3 &color)=0 (defined in Atoms::DrawContext)Atoms::DrawContextpure virtual
setColor(const AtomsCore::Vector4 &color)=0 (defined in Atoms::DrawContext)Atoms::DrawContextpure virtual
setFontSize(double value)=0 (defined in Atoms::DrawContext)Atoms::DrawContextpure virtual
setLineSize(double value)=0 (defined in Atoms::DrawContext)Atoms::DrawContextpure virtual
setLineStyle(int value, unsigned short pattern)=0 (defined in Atoms::DrawContext)Atoms::DrawContextpure virtual
setPointSize(double value)=0 (defined in Atoms::DrawContext)Atoms::DrawContextpure virtual
setViewport(int x, int y, int w, int h)=0 (defined in Atoms::DrawContext)Atoms::DrawContextpure virtual
text(const std::string &text, const AtomsCore::Vector3 &pos)=0 (defined in Atoms::DrawContext)Atoms::DrawContextpure virtual
text2d(const std::string &text, const AtomsCore::Vector2 &pos)=0 (defined in Atoms::DrawContext)Atoms::DrawContextpure virtual
translate(const AtomsCore::Vector3 &value)=0 (defined in Atoms::DrawContext)Atoms::DrawContextpure virtual
triangles(const std::vector< AtomsCore::Vector3 > &points)=0 (defined in Atoms::DrawContext)Atoms::DrawContextpure virtual
triangles2d(const std::vector< AtomsCore::Vector2 > &points)=0 (defined in Atoms::DrawContext)Atoms::DrawContextpure virtual
viewport(int &x, int &y, int &w, int &h)=0 (defined in Atoms::DrawContext)Atoms::DrawContextpure virtual
~DrawContext() (defined in Atoms::DrawContext)Atoms::DrawContextvirtual